One year in office: Kwara Central showers encomiums on Gov AbdulRasaq

Date: 2020-06-20

Last Thursday, inside the expansive hall of Kwara Hotel, Ilorin the state capital, with strict obedience to Social distancing protocols of Covid-19, all the elected and appointed office holders from Kwara Central senatorial district gathered to pass a vote of confidence on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Rasaq.

The move, according to Saturday Vanguard check was to tell the whole world that the home base of the governor which is Kwara Central senatorial district was solidly behind him, against the backdrop of the simmering crisis within the ruling All Progressives Congress in the state, and the alleged political differences which Governor AbdulRazaq was said to be having with some political leaders in the state.

The highest ranking officer from the zone in the State House of Assembly, the Majority leader, Hon Magaji Olaoye representing Afon constituency said the governor's achievements in the last one year were numerous but was particularly impressed by the permanent solution to water crisis by the governor, a challenge that had defied solutions from the previous administrations.

Commissioner for Tertiary Education in the state, Hajia Saadat Modibbo who spoke on behalf of other women in the cabinet commended the governor for the appointment of higher number of female in the cabinet with nine out of 16 commissioners being female which was the first in the history of the state.

"This is the first state that we will have female more than the male in cabinet in Nigeria, we are grateful to the governor for that exemplary gesture", she said.

Modibbo however believed that there was the need to continue to dialogue with other members of the party whom she described as members of the same family but who may have one issue or the other with the governor until truce was achieved.

Representing the voice of the youths, Mr Abdul Olododo, Special adviser to the governor on Agriculture said by his appointment the governor has demonstrated the confidence he has in the youths, saying, "the governor has shown me that leadership is not about feeling on top, but about serving the people"

The governor's Special Assistant on Strategy, Abdulateef Alakawa at the end of the programme read a resolution on the vote of confidence passed on the governor by the elected and appointed members of Kwara Central senatorial district which was affirmed by all.
